    Good grief. I don't think I have the time or willpower to finish this list out because it'd take me like 3 days of looking into spells and the like to really come up with one stationary answer.

    I change my spells constantly. Rarely a day goes by in Baldur's Gate where I have not switched up my spells for the challenge at hand.

    The only things I always, always, always have on my guys:

    Stoneskin/Iron Skins
    Blur + Mirror Images for mages
    Armor of Faith + at least one Lesser Restoration for Clerics
    Breach/Ruby Ray of Reversal/Lower Magic Resist (basically always, always make sure I have a bunch of spells prepped to strip buffs off casters)

    Summon Woodland Being is another spell I frequently make use of for druids. A level 4 spell that summons a creature with level 5-7 divine spells? Nerf now, plz.

    Mage: Spell slots are pretty limited but okay, here's what I would bring to an average unspecified day:

    1. Magic Missile x7
    2. Mirror Image x4, Melf's Acid Arrow x2, Resist Fear x1
    3. Skull Trap x3, Melf's Minute Meteor x3, Dispel Magic x1
    4. Stoneskin x2, Improved Invisibility x1, Greater Malison x1, Secret Word x2
    5. Chaos x2, Breach x2, Spell Immunity x1, Sunfire/Cone of Cold x1
    6. Flesh to Stone x3, Contingency x1, True Sight x1
    7. Finger of Death x2, Prismatic Spray x1, Sphere of Chaos x1
    8. Abi Dalzim's Horrid Wilting x3
    9. Spell Trap, Time Stop

    Note: For defense all you really need is mirror images, stoneskin, spell trap, and a ring of fire resistance. Put a Mislead, Invisibility or Stoneskin in your Contingency.
